The magistrates of the First Criminal Chamber of the Court of Appeals of the National District have convened the hearing where the appeals filed by those involved in the so-called Antipulpo Case will be heard, a judicial process that investigates an alleged embezzlement of the State of more than 5 billion pesos.<\/p>\n\n<p>This process seeks to review the sentences handed down against the members of an alleged corruption network that, according to the authorities, operated through schemes of irregular contracts and illicit operations with various public sector institutions.<\/p>\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Main figures under process<\/h2>\n\n<p>Among the defendants seeking to reverse or modify the sentences imposed by the courts of first instance are high-profile figures from the past public administration:<\/p>\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Juan Alexis Medina S\u00e1nchez, identified as the ringleader of the structure.<\/li>\n<li>Magaly Medina S\u00e1nchez.<\/li>\n<li>Fernando Rosa, former director of Fonper.<\/li>\n<li>Freddy Hidalgo, former Minister of Public Health.<\/li>\n<li>Antonio Germos\u00e9n And\u00fajar, former Comptroller General of the Republic.<\/li>\n<li>Aquiles Alejandro Christopher S\u00e1nchez, former OISOE official.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">The position of the Public Prosecutor&#8217;s Office<\/h2>\n\n<p>During the preliminary phases of the trial, the prosecution has maintained a firm stance, arguing that the documentary and testimonial evidence is sufficient to prove that Alexis Medina S\u00e1nchez led a scheme designed to capture state funds. Prosecutor Elizabeth Paredes has emphasized in her presentations that institutions such as the Ministry of Public Works and the OISOE were targets of maneuvers to irregularly award contracts.<\/p>\n\n<blockquote class=\"wp-block-quote is-layout-flow wp-block-quote-is-layout-flow\"><p>The Public Prosecutor&#8217;s Office maintains that the network used a complex scheme of front men and shell companies, such as Domedical Supply SRL and General Supply SRL, to divert millions in payments from the Ministry of Finance and other state agencies.<\/p><\/blockquote>\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Operations structure<\/h2>\n\n<p>The file details how third parties, including Jos\u00e9 Dolores Santana, were used to appear in public contracts and conceal the final benefit of those involved. In addition to those mentioned, the process links figures such as Lina de la Cruz Vargas, Pachrysty Ram\u00edrez, and V\u00edctor Encarnaci\u00f3n, while other actors, such as the former director of the OISOE, Francisco Pag\u00e1n, have already received prior convictions for their direct participation in the events.<\/p>\n\n<p>With the start of these hearings in the Court of Appeals, the Dominican judicial system prepares to evaluate the validity of the arguments presented by both the Public Prosecutor&#8217;s Office and the technical defense teams, in what represents one of the most complex and relevant judicial processes of recent years in the country.<\/p>","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Antipulpo Case: Court of Appeals begins review of sentences for millionaire embezzlement Dominican justice enters a decisive stage this Tuesday.
